There are 21 concubines of Ming Taizu Zhu Yuanzhang who have a title and appear in the annals of history, and there are probably more other women without names. These women gave birth to 26 sons and 16 daughters for Zhu Yuanzhang, the youngest of whom was Princess Baoqing, the sixteenth imperial daughter. Princess Baoqing saved her mother's life, but after marrying someone, she found that she was not a person and died of depression twenty years later.

Princess Baoqing was the daughter of Zhang Meiren, born in the twenty-eighth year of Hongwu (1395), when Zhu Yuanzhang was already a 68-year-old man. Since ancient times, parents like the youngest child, and Zhu Yuanzhang is naturally very happy to add another daughter in recent years, and he also cares for this daughter. However, in the thirty-first year of Hongwu (1398), on the tenth day of the first leap month of May, Zhu Yuanzhang died, and Princess Baoqing was only three years old at this time. Originally, Zhu Yuanzhang issued an edict to the concubines to be martyred, but because Princess Baoqing was too young, she left Zhang Meiren. Speaking of this Baoqing princess, she saved her mother's life.

During the reign of Emperor Jianwen, Princess Baoqing was raised by Zhang Meiren. However, after the Battle of Jingnan, Zhu Di took the throne, and the custody of this Princess Baoqing changed. "Chengzu ascended the throne, the lord was eight years old, and Empress Renxiao was like a daughter." Empress Xu raised this little sister-in-law as a daughter and raised her as a big girl, and reached the age when she should get married.

Zhu Di made several selections, and finally selected Zhao Hui, a thousand households guarding the Jinchuan Gate. In the eleventh year of Yongle (1413), the 19-year-old Princess Baoqing was married. Because Princess Baoqing was deeply favored by her brother, "the Lord was caressed by the queen, pretended to be his lord, and sent the crown prince to the palace on the eve of his marriage." "This donkey" Hui guarded the Jinchuan Gate with a thousand households, and when he was more than twenty years old, he was magnificent in appearance, so he chose to be the lord of Shang. "It also looks like a good marriage."

But the shoe fit is not suitable only the foot knows. After Princess Baoqing married, she found that this Zhao Hui was a clumsy child, that is, she was just good-looking and well-born. After he was a hero Zhao He, he inherited his father's official title at a young age, and the two were only 20 years old when they were married. But Zhao Hui not only fooled around with a group of fox friends all day long, but also often carried her outside to fool around, causing a lot of lawsuits. "The family is rich and luxurious, and the concubines are more than a hundred people." Since the princess of the Ming Dynasty could not remarry, Princess Baoqing could only endure it. In this way, Princess Baoqing gradually lost weight and finally died in the eighth year of Xuande (1433), when she was only 40 years old. Zhao Hui also had a smooth career, serving 6 emperors successively, Chengzu, Renzong, Xuanzong, Yingzong, Jingdi, and Xianzong, and successively took charge of the affairs of the Nanjing Governor's Mansion and the Zongren Mansion, and thus accumulated huge wealth. In the twenty-second year of Chenghua (1476), Zhao Hui, who had enjoyed all the glory and wealth, fell ill and died at the age of 90. At this time, 43 years have passed since the death of Princess Baoqing.
